Transaction 8ab651eec377f379be1080a5535b1d67d4779d8389475534a1e243f017a6c72d
1 Input
1 Output
-
8ab651eec377f379be1080a5535b1d67d4779d8389475534a1e243f017a6c72d:0
- value
- 46409
- script pubkey
- OP_0 OP_PUSHBYTES_20 52c7b5f0eb17d2385945ce5f2a193cd51dba8b06
- address
- bc1q2trmtu8tzlfrsk29ee0j5xfu65wm4zcxz0a3gl